Just got off the phone with Carlisle. They're doing it differently than they did it last year. Now, the only ones who can pre-order a camping sticker are those on the showfield. This isn't a problem, because that's where we'll be...so that's cool. BUT...they will not give me a block of assigned spots. Apparently they had too much wasted space last year from people reserving blocks and then not utilizing the space. So, it's pretty much first-come, first-serve.
BUT...if we all order our camping stickers (we WILL NOT get assigned #'s like last year), it can still work out. If we all drive over to the camping site at the same time, we will be parked in the order that we drive over there. So, when we're ready to head over, we just make a caravan and we're good to go.
These "new" changes were just voted on by the Carlisle people last night and the website will soon be reflecting it, so check it every once in a while. Oh, you will also be able to order it online this year, whereas last year you had to call to order/pay for your camping spot.
In summary:
1) Wait a couple of days till carsatcarlisle.com is updated.
2) Register for your own camping spot if you want to camp. Order/pay online.
3) Go to Carlisle, have fun.
